Case Study: Kathy Ferrara 
Founder and Director, Faith Events Live

History: Faith Events Live hosted “Spaghetti for the Soul” with Kathy Troccoli and Ellie Lofaro at the Christian Life Center (CLC) in Bensalem, Pennsylvania, for 850 attendees.

Requirements: “The most important thing for me is who I will be working with,” Ferrara says. “Do they really want our event? Since we seek to be unique with our events, we need a certain amount of leeway; if a venue is set in its ways, I will back away from it.” 

Results: She found what she wanted at Christian Life Center, in the person of Dan Corbisello, business administrator of the church, who also jumps in to prepare omelets and box lunches for special events at the center, which has a 1,800-seat auditorium, a 250-seat auditorium, banquet facilities for 320 guests, a VIP boardroom and lounge, a coffee shop and state-of-the-art sound, light and projection technology.

Inspiration: The large foyer was transformed into a nostalgic, Italian-themed kitchen. As an added touch, butlers carrying trays of cannoli greeted attendees.
